2/14 CBS2 Sunday Morning Weather Headlines

By Mark McIntyre, CBS2 Meteorologist/Weather Producer

Good morning everybody - no other way to say it, it's brutally cold out. Everyone's starting off either right around 0 or below 0. Wind chills are dangerous too with things feeling like 15 to 40 degrees below! Bundle up or just stay inside today.

Tomorrow is when things get interesting. We'll have a bump in temps and it looks like we'll get back to the freezing mark...but some snow will start falling before that. Looks like snow moves in for the afternoon before it changes to rain late at night. How much? Could get a few slushy inches before the change...some spots north & west might have more icing to deal with, and immediate coastal spots may be just rain.

Tuesday will be a windy & warm soaker. Temps spike into the low 50s for some with heavy rain through the early afternoon. Heavy rain on top of frozen ground could lead to some local flooding & runoff issues, so we'll keep you posted on that.
